Bitcoin feels quieter right now, but historically that’s often when it’s doing its most important work. The price may chop sideways and dominate fewer headlines, yet adoption, infrastructure, and long-term holders continue to build in the background. Periods like this tend to separate speculation from conviction.

What keeps me focused on Bitcoin isn’t short-term price action, but its properties: fixed supply, censorship resistance, and the ability to self-custody value outside the traditional financial system. Those fundamentals haven’t changed, even when sentiment does.

I’m curious how others here think about Bitcoin during these lower-noise phases. Do you view them as accumulation periods, times to step back, or simply part of the cost of holding a truly long-term asset?
